Contact lens correction of astigmatism is reviewed. According to literature data, rigid gas permeable lenses are the lenses of choice in correction of irregular and high astigmatism. The crucial advantage of rigid gas permeable lenses is clear vision and stable correction of astigmatism. Soft toric lenses ensure quick adaptation and comfort. A method has been developed whereby refractive microlenses can be produced in poly (methyl methacrylate) by excimer laser irradiation at λ = 248 nm. The lenses are formed by a combined photochemical and thermal process.
